Ensuring Proper Curing

Curing is a vital process that contributes to the overall strength and durability of newly repaired floors. It involves maintaining adequate moisture, temperature, and time to ensure the ultimate development of floor integrity. The specific requirements may vary depending on the materials used. Contractors should adhere to manufacturer recommendations to achieve the best results.

In addition to following guidelines, environmental conditions play a crucial role in the curing process. High temperatures and low humidity can accelerate drying, potentially leading to surface cracking and weakening of the material. Conversely, excessive moisture can prolong drying times and hinder proper curing. Monitoring these factors closely ensures that the floor maintains its performance and longevity.

Factors Affecting Curing Time

Curing time for floor repairs is influenced by several environmental and material conditions. Temperature plays a significant role; higher temperatures generally accelerate the curing process while cooler conditions can prolong it. Humidity levels also impact the time required, as moist environments may slow down the hardening of materials. Additionally, the thickness of the applied layer affects curing; thicker layers often take longer to set completely compared to thinner applications.

The type of flooring material used is another determining factor in the curing timeline. Different materials have unique chemical compositions that dictate their drying and hardening rates. Polyurethane, for instance, can cure faster than traditional cement-based compounds. User techniques during application can also alter curing times. Proper mixing of components and adhering to recommended application thicknesses can enhance the efficiency of the curing process.

Protective Measures Post-Repair

After any repair work is completed, implementing protective measures is vital to ensure the longevity and integrity of the flooring. Appropriate barriers can be set up to prevent foot traffic and equipment from disturbing the freshly repaired surface. Using temporary coverings, such as protective mats or sheets, can further shield the area from potential damage during ongoing work or regular usage in adjacent spaces.

In addition to physical barriers, communication plays a crucial role. Informing all personnel about the repair work and the importance of avoiding the area helps instil a sense of responsibility within the team. Signage can be placed strategically to alert individuals to exercise caution. Regular monitoring of the site during the initial days post-repair will ensure adherence to these protective measures and highlight any emerging concerns.

Best Practices for Floor Protection

After repairs are completed, it is essential to implement protective measures to safeguard the floor’s integrity. One effective method is to lay down protective coverings, such as floor mats or plywood sheets, especially in high-traffic areas. These materials can help minimise the risk of scratches, dents, and other types of damage while allowing for air circulation to promote curing. It is also crucial to limit foot traffic on the repaired areas for a specified duration, depending on the type of flooring installed.

Environmental factors play a significant role in the care of the newly repaired flooring. Maintaining a suitable temperature and humidity level in the premises encourages optimal curing and reduces the risk of warping or other structural issues. Regular cleaning with gentle, non-abrasive products helps remove dirt and debris without compromising the newly repaired surface. Additionally, it is important to communicate with occupants about the need for caution around the repaired areas to ensure everyone understands the importance of protecting the floor as it settles.

Regular Maintenance Checks

Routine inspections of flooring play a vital role in preserving its integrity and appearance. During these checks, attention should be paid to any signs of wear, damage, or changes in surface texture. Identifying issues early can help prevent more extensive problems later. Inspect joints and seams for gaps or cracks that might allow moisture to affect the underlying structure.

Focusing on high-traffic areas is crucial since they are more likely to show signs of deterioration. Regular cleaning will also contribute to the longevity of the flooring material. Establishing a simple checklist for maintenance can streamline this process, making it easier to ensure all aspects are covered systematically. Maintaining consistent records of inspections can aid in spotting trends and adjusting care strategies as needed.

How to Conduct Routine Inspections

Routine inspections play a crucial role in ensuring floor integrity after repairs. Begin by examining the surface for any visible cracks, warping, or discolouration. These signs may indicate underlying issues that need immediate attention. Use standard measuring tools to assess any unevenness in the flooring, as this can affect not only aesthetics but also safety. It is also important to monitor the joints for signs of wear or damage, as they often bear the brunt of foot traffic.

Furthermore, it is advisable to adhere to a regular schedule for these inspections, ideally every few months, depending on the type of flooring and its usage. Documenting findings meticulously can help track changes over time, making it easier to identify problem areas. Consider involving professionals when significant issues are noted, as their expertise can provide deeper insights into necessary corrective actions. In this way, maintaining a proactive approach towards regular checks can prolong the life of the floor and enhance its overall performance.
